As Vice President for Accion’s Resource Development team, Erika Eurkus oversees individual philanthropy at Accion. She has over twenty years of experience in securing and managing contributions from individual, foundation, and corporate donors.
Before her current role, Erika worked as a loan officer and program manager for small business lender Working Capital and Accion in the U.S., where she mobilized loan fund capital and also helped launch several corporate partnerships, including the Brewing the American Dream partnership between Samuel Adams and Accion.
Erika served as Secretary of the Board of the Massachusetts Community Banking Council and is a past advisory board member of the Pioneer Institute and Mayor Tom Menino’s Onein3 young professional organization. She is a member of the Boston Business Journal’s 40 Under 40 class of 2007. She holds a degree in international relations from Northwestern University.
